Sale of London City Airport to Boost Business Tourism for ExCeL London
30/10/2006
The sale of London City Airport to a US-led consortia will increase the volume of business travellers to London¡¯s eastside, and directly impact on ExCeL London¡¯s profile in International markets according to the venue¡¯s CEO, Jamie Buchan.
Commenting on the sale, Jamie Buchan said: ¡°This sale is great news for ExCeL London and the local area generally. London City Airport is as a vital component in the future development of London¡¯s eastside and as a venue, we have seen how business travellers are increasingly utilising the gateway. With all of the increased traffic and developments expected as we build towards 2012, further investment ¨C such as that suggested by these reports ¨C is essential to accommodate the growing volume and interest in the region.¡±
Buchan continued: ¡°London City Airport has been a tremendous success under Dermot Desmond and we are excited about the continued investment that the new owners have said they will bring to the area. We are looking forward to working with the new owners to ensure that together we are taking London¡¯s eastside to markets that need to have the region on their radar in the coming years.¡±
The Docklands airport was put up for sale earlier this year by Irish owner Dermot Desmond and an agreement has been signed with a consortium comprising AIG Financial Products Corp and Global Infrastructure Partners.
Although the value of the transaction has not been disclosed it is estimated that the sale is worth around ¡ê750m. This is reflective of the confidence in the airport¡¯s development potential to boost passenger numbers to three and half million by 2015 and eight million by 2030.
